Vetted 15 Best Creatine Supplements on Amazon: Boost Your Performance Today Jumpstart your fitness journey with the 15 best creatine supplements on Amazon—discover which one will elevate your performance to new heights! Berkley ValloneJanuary 27, 2025 View Post